South Bend's DTSB Paddy Party and Pub Tour has been canceled because of the coronavirus.
The St. Patrick's Day celebration was scheduled to be held Friday at 5 p.m. at Four Winds Field.
The downtown St. Patrick's Day Parade on March 14 has also been cancelled.
A patient in St. Joseph County tested positive for COVID-19, the St. Joseph County Department of Health announced earlier Wednesday.
